Standing over 600 feet above the downtown core, the Calgary Tower has been an icon in the city skyline for over 40 years. Offering uncompromising views in every direction, visiting the tower has become a proud tradition for Calgarians and their guests.

Calgary’s own revolving restaurant on top of the Calgary Tower offers more than just magnificent views of the City of Calgary & the Rocky Mountains. Unforgettable food, an award winning wine list and a contemporary design all come together to make this unique dining destination a step above the rest.

WHAT YOU'LL DO
• Ensure a clean and sanitary stock of dishes, utensils, glasses, pots/pans, and cooking equipment is consistently available for kitchen and food service.
• Sort, stack, and load dirty dishware into dish racks in an organized manner to maximize machine capacity and reduce breakage.
• Operate dishwashing equipment in a safe and controlled manner.
• Unload dishware, distributing and storing in designated storage areas.
• Maintain ongoing communication with all departments affecting the kitchen.
• Aid kitchen staff in food prep.
• Ensure the highest level of hygiene and food safety is adhered to according to the restaurant’s standards.
• Ensure that the dishwashing area and equipment is always maintained at the highest level of cleanliness.
• Consistently conduct yourself in a professional and positive manner.
• Aid in maintaining department objectives and ensure they are met and exceeded.
• Perform other related ad-hoc duties as required.
